The Timeline of SEO Success

The typical timeline for SEO effectiveness ranges from three months to a year, as indicated by an Ahrefs LinkedIn and Twitter poll involving around 4,300 participants. This aligns with our firsthand observations with clients. To provide a clearer understanding of the SEO process, we’ll guide you through each phase.

1. Initial Changes (1 to 3 Months):

During the first few months of implementing SEO strategies, you can expect to see some early progress. Website audits, keyword research, on-page optimizations, and technical fixes are generally the primary focus during this stage. Although significant ranking improvements might still need to be evident, these foundational steps are crucial for setting the stage for future gains.

2. Building Momentum (3 to 6 Months):

As your website becomes more SEO-friendly and search engines crawl and index your optimized content, you may notice some ranking and organic traffic improvements. Building momentum can be gradual, but this period is essential for gaining traction in the SERPs.

3. Steady Growth (6 to 12 Months):

The 6 to 12-month mark is a critical stage for SEO success. By now, your website should have a solid foundation of optimized content, relevant backlinks, and an improved user experience. As search engines recognize your website’s authority and relevance, you can expect steady rankings and organic traffic growth.

4. Competitive Rankings (12+ Months):

Beyond the first year, your website’s rankings and organic traffic should continue to improve. Your website should be more competitive in search results at this stage, driving substantial organic traffic. Consistent efforts in content creation, link building, and technical optimizations will contribute to maintaining and improving your search engine positions.

Factors Influencing the SEO Timeline:

The length of time it takes for SEO efforts to be successful depends on several factors. These include:

  • Website Age and Authority: Established websites may experience quicker results due to their existing domain authority and trust.
  • Competition: The level of competition in your niche and the keywords you target can impact the timeline for seeing SEO improvements.
  • Content Quality: High-quality, relevant content that addresses user intent is essential for SEO success.
  • Backlinks: Acquiring authoritative backlinks from reputable sources can significantly impact your rankings.
  • Technical optimization: Ensuring your website is both technically sound and user-friendly increases the likelihood that it will rank highly.
